Color Wheel Refresher - Sherwin-Williams Triadic color scheme. This scheme makes use of three colors an equal distance apart on the color wheel, such as red, yellow and blue; or yellow-green, blue-violet and red-orange. Colour wheel with labels. Color Wheel - Color Calculator | Sessions College The color wheel is a chart representing the relationships between colors. Based on a circle showing the colors of the spectrum originally fashioned by Sir Isaac Newton in 1666, the colour wheel he created serves many purposes today. Painters use it to identify colors to mix and designers use it to choose colors that go well together. Looking at the colour wheel, we can divide it into two sections. The colours on either side are called warm an cold colours. See if you can determine which are cold colours and which are warm. Yup you guessed it - red, yellow, orange, maroon are warm colours and blue, green, violet and lime are cold colours.

See color wheel stock video clips Image type Orientation Color People Artists Sort by Popular Abstract Designs and Shapes Icons and Graphics Ink, Paint, and Drawing Materials color wheel color theory infographic watercolor Color wheel - Wikipedia The typical artists' paint or pigment color wheel includes the blue, red, and yellow primary colors. The corresponding secondary colors are green, orange, and violet or purple. The tertiary colors are green-yellow, yellow-orange, orange-red, red-violet/purple, purple/violet-blue and blue-green. Color wheel - color theory and calculator | Canva Colors In the RGB color wheel, these hues are red, orange, yellow, chartreuse green, green, spring green, cyan, azure, blue, violet, magenta and rose. The color wheel can be divided into primary, secondary and tertiary colors. Primary colors in the RGB color wheel are the colors that, added together, create pure white light. The CMYK Color Wheel - Dawn's Brain The color wheel above shows three colors in addition to the primary colors. In between each pair of primaries is a secondary color: a mix of two primaries. Cyan and magenta make blue. Magenta and yellow make red. Yellow and cyan make green. I've shown a formula for each color. The numbers are the respective percentages of Cyan, Magenta ...
Color Wheel (Ultimate Color Matching Guide) - Designing Idea On the color wheel, the secondary colors are located between two primary colors. They are the building blocks for all the other colors on the wheel. Secondary Colors These colors are made by mixing the primary colors. The 3 secondary colors are green, orange, and purple. Green is made from mixing blue and yellow.
